PART II.
MANDATORY COVERAGE
[§393-11] Coverage of regular employees by
group prepaid health care plan. Every employer who pays to a regular
employee monthly wages in an amount of at least 86.67 times the minimum hourly
wage, specified in chapter 387, as rounded off by regulation of the director,
shall provide coverage of such employee by a prepaid group health care plan
qualifying under section 393-7 with a prepaid health care plan contractor in
accordance with the provisions of this chapter. [L 1974, c 210, pt of §1]
